. Let p and q be the propositions p: He is rich q: He is happy Write the following propositions using p and q and logical connectives.

a. If he is rich, then he is unhappy.

b. He is neither rich nor happy.

c. It is necessary to be poor, in order to be happy.

d. He is either rich or happy (or both).
